938 Framlingham Ct is located in Lake Mary, near the intersection of FL-46 and North Sun Drive. This low-rise building has just one story and holds 7 condominium units. Built in 1986, the structure provides a comfortable living environment. The nearby water body, Lake Monroe, adds to the scenic charm of the area.
Unit sizes range from 948 to 1,048 square feet. Each unit contains 2 bedrooms, ideal for small families or roommates. Prices for these homes vary from $186,000 to $255,000. In the past year, the average closed price was around $170,000, with a price per square foot of $171. Units generally spend about 268 days on the market.
Residents enjoy a variety of amenities. Recreation facilities include a community pool and hot tub. A clubhouse and fitness center are also available for leisure and fitness activities. Assigned parking spaces help ensure easy access, while well-kept common areas enhance the building's overall appearance.
Nearby dining options include Toojay's Gourmet Deli and the Thai Corner Restaurant, perfect for quick meals or casual dining. The Custom Communications Group school is also close by for families with children. Shopping centers lay nearby, creating a practical living space.

This neighborhood indicates a good mix of people which makes it a good place for families. About 13.33% are children aged 0–14, 20.95% are young adults between 15–29, 17.21% are adults aged 30–44, 27.02% are in the 45–59 range and 21.49% are seniors aged 60 and above.
Commuting options are also varying where 75.75% of residents relying on driving, while others prefer public transit around 3.22%, walking around 2.77%, biking around 0%, allowing residents to choose travel modes that best fit their daily routines.
Most homes in the area are with 55.88% of units are rented and 44.12% are owner occupied.
The neighborhood offers different household types. About 25.63% are single family homes and 4.37% are multi family units. Around 33.92% are single-person households, while 66.08% are multi person households. This mix works well for families, roommates, and individuals.
Education levels in the neighborhood vary widely where 19.39% of residents have bachelor’s degrees. Around 24.86% have high school or college education. Another 15.42% hold diplomas while 14.62% have completed postgraduate studies. The remaining are 25.71% with other types of qualifications.
